Job Summary Under the direction of a Radiologist and/or Imaging Manager, the Mammography Technologist performs mammography procedures in accordance with applicable scope and standards of practice. This position involves preparing equipment, educating patients, performing imaging procedures, and maintaining quality control standards. The role also includes ensuring compliance with relevant regulations and guidelines, assisting with interventional procedures, and providing superior patient care across various age groups. Essential Functions Reviews patient history and physician orders; educates patient regarding procedures to ensure understanding and cooperation Positions patient and performs imaging procedures, including biopsies and stereotactic procedures Monitors patient condition continually and responds to changes as appropriate Implements safety protocols and performs quality control checks on imaging equipment Analyzes imaging results for quality and accuracy, takes corrective action as necessary Enters and transmits scan results; maintains accurate patient records and documentation Assists with interventional procedures, including needle localization and fine needle aspiration Ensures compliance with Mammography Quality Standards Act (MQSA) and other relevant regulations Troubleshoots equipment malfunctions and reports issues to the supervisor Participates in safety training and follows protocols for exposure to bloodborne pathogens and hazardous materials Knowledge/Skills/Abilities/Expectations Demonstrates superior interpersonal and communication skills with patients and team members Ability to perform critical thinking and decisive judgment in a fast-paced environment Ability to work independently with minimal supervision and adapt to changing priorities Proficiency in the use of imaging software and mammography tracking systems Knowledge of infection control procedures and radiation safety standards Physical ability to lift and move patients, and perform frequent bending, stooping, and reaching Ability to handle exposure to bloodborne pathogens and hazardous chemicals safely Maintains confidentiality of patient information and adheres to hospital policies and procedures Participates in ongoing training and professional development Maintains exam rooms and equipment in a clean and organized condition Attends departmental meetings and safety briefings as required Education Graduate of an accredited Radiologic Technology program, required Must hold ARRT certification in Radiography and Mammography (M), required Completion of 200 mammograms within a 24-month period, preferred Licenses/Certifications Active state Radiologic Technologist license, required Basic Life Support (BLS) certification, required SCRQSA registration (if applicable), required Experience Minimum of one year of general radiography experience, preferred Minimum of two years of experience in Mammography, preferred Demonstrated experience in quality assurance and quality control in mammography, preferred
